"catastrophic backtracking" meaning in All languages combined

  1. (regular expressions) An excessively large amount of backtracking that occurs with certain regular expressions, due to an exponentially large number of possible matching paths to check. Tags: uncountable Categories (topical): Regular expressions Synonyms: runaway backtracking
